Wenhong Zu is a scholar working on Infectious Diseases, Cardiology and Cardiovascular Medicine and Molecular Biology. According to data from OpenAlex, Wenhong Zu has authored 8 papers receiving a total of 80 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Infectious Diseases, 3 papers in Cardiology and Cardiovascular Medicine and 2 papers in Molecular Biology. Recurrent topics in Wenhong Zu's work include SARS-CoV-2 and COVID-19 Research (3 papers), Viral Infections and Immunology Research (3 papers) and Blood properties and coagulation (2 papers). Wenhong Zu is often cited by papers focused on SARS-CoV-2 and COVID-19 Research (3 papers), Viral Infections and Immunology Research (3 papers) and Blood properties and coagulation (2 papers). Wenhong Zu collaborates with scholars based in China, United States and Australia. Wenhong Zu's co-authors include Naum Khutoryansky, Horacio Sosa, Xu Tan, Stephen J. Elledge, Mamie Z. Li, Chao Jiang, Nianchao Qian, Yuanqing Xu, Anthony C. Liang and Xiaoying Tang and has published in prestigious journals such as Nature Communications, SHILAP Revista de lepidopterología and Computers & Structures.
